Launch of Flagship CellMaker PLUS™ - the World’s
first dual-mode single-use bioreactor
For immediate release 1st October 2007: Cellexus Biosystems plc, the PLUS
quoted specialist in the design of novel disposable technology for growing
cells, is pleased to announce the launch of its new flagship single-use
bioreactor CellMaker PLUS™ for the culture of all cell types.
The CellMaker PLUS is launched today at the BioProcess International conference
in Boston and includes a wealth of new technologies for the culture of all cell
types. This is accompanied by the fusion of single-use technologies that have
now been incorporated into a new disposable bag called the HybridBagTM. This
latest product is a world first of its kind and unifies the principles of
airlift (as applied in the CellexusBag™) with those applied in Stirred Tank
Reactors (STRs) in a single-use culture bag. The CellMaker PLUS bioreactor
together with the single-use component the HybridBag, perform several important
operations which significantly improve culture growth compared with shaker-flask
systems and other bioreactor designs.
The novel shape of the HybridBag is key to the effective mixing and dissolved
gas control. Cylindrical bioreactors need large paddles and baffles to disrupt
circular motion and create turbulent flow and shear forces. Mixing and aeration
in the HybridBag differs in that it is from top-to-bottom - quite literally
turning stirring on its head. This is achieved by using the flow of aeration
gases from the integrated sparge tube and the use of integrated propellers, all
of which are completely disposable.
In additional to this innovation, new oxygen sensors (called WIDGETS™), are now
integrated as standard in all HybridBags. These are used to measure the
concentration of dissolved oxygen and data is fed-back to the new CellMaker PLUS
Controller, which then regulates and adjusts the flow of air, nitrogen and
carbon dioxide to the cells. A similar WIDGET sensor is integrated into the
HybridBag to measure pH.
Dr Kevin Auton, CEO stated: “The CellMaker PLUS and the HybridBag are the next
generation of products from Cellexus Biosystems and are designed specifically
for mammalian cell culture but the system can equally be optimized for growing
oxygen hungry E.coli and Pichia pastoris. These innovations in single-use
bioreactors have been combined to achieve “the best of all worlds”. We will
start to see a progression to multi-modal or hybrid, single-use bioreactors that
perform multiple operations. New innovations being developed and some of the
challenges associated with manufacturing single-use products are being overcome,
and you will see more innovative combinations of these technologies. Certainly
we will see lower cost, truly single-use sensors in every culture bag.”

Cellexus Biosystems plc has developed a range of value-added disposables to
help researchers in the biopharmaceutical industry and academia develop new
biopharmaceutical products from cell lines. Biopharmaceuticals are the new breed
of medicines, generated by culturing cells in bioreactors. These medicines are
often proteins, such as antibodies, or can be vaccines. The potential of future
medical treatments offered by stem cell research would also fall within this
category. Sales of biopharmaceuticals reached US$60 billion in 2005 and are
growing at 20% per annum.
The Company has developed a family of products. Three products have all been
developed around the core technology - the CellexusBagTM and the HybridBagTM-
and are marketed under the name: CellMaker Lite2TM, CellMaker Lite2 HybridTM and
the CellMaker PLUSTM. These products offer significant technological
improvements for cell culture and cell growth to the biopharmaceutical industry
in the fast-growing single-use market.
Unlike competitive products, the CellexusBag products do not need to be shaken,
rocked or rolled, which means the equipment used to manage the cell culture
process is very simple and inexpensive. A patent application protecting the
Company's intellectual property was filed in December 2005 with a second patent
application filed in June 2007.
